可执行小程序 可执行小程序的软件

小编 09-04 9

当然可以,以下是一个简单的可执行小程序,使用Python编写,这个小程序将创建一个简单的计算器,能够进行基本的算术运算。

简单的计算器小程序
def add(x, y):
    """加法函数"""
    return x + y
def subtract(x, y):
    """减法函数"""
    return x - y
def multiply(x, y):
    """乘法函数"""
    return x * y
def divide(x, y):
    """除法函数"""
    if y != 0:
        return x / y
    else:
        return "除数不能为0"
def main():
    print("欢迎使用简单计算器!")
    print("输入'q'退出程序。")
    
    while True:
        print("
请选择运算:")
        print("1.加法")
        print("2.减法")
        print("3.乘法")
        print("4.除法")
        
        choice = input("输入选择(1/2/3/4): ")
        
        if choice == 'q':
            print("感谢使用简单计算器!")
            break
        
        if choice in ('1', '2', '3', '4'):
            num1 = float(input("输入第一个数字: "))
            num2 = float(input("输入第二个数字: "))
            
            if choice == '1':
                print(f"{num1} + {num2} = {add(num1, num2)}")
            
            elif choice == '2':
                print(f"{num1} - {num2} = {subtract(num1, num2)}")
            
            elif choice == '3':
                print(f"{num1} * {num2} = {multiply(num1, num2)}")
            
            elif choice == '4':
                result = divide(num1, num2)
                if isinstance(result, str):
                    print(result)
                else:
                    print(f"{num1} / {num2} = {result}")
        else:
            print("无效输入")
if __name__ == "__main__":
    main()

可执行小程序 可执行小程序的软件

要执行这个小程序,你需要将这段代码保存到一个.py文件中,例如calculator.py,你可以在命令行或终端中运行这个文件,确保你有一个Python解释器安装在你的计算机上。

在命令行或终端中,你可以使用以下命令来运行这个小程序:

python calculator.py

这个小程序将提供一个简单的文本界面,允许用户选择他们想要进行的运算类型(加法、减法、乘法或除法),输入两个数字,然后程序会输出结果,用户可以通过输入q来退出程序。

请注意,这个小程序非常基础,没有错误处理机制,例如检查用户输入是否为数字,在实际应用中,你可能需要添加更多的错误检查和用户友好的功能。

The End
微信